Output d27f0bf39eb7990b11a0531543349fdf691ac7ababd327eb00b702239cc9d0f6:0

value
17768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a127a900bccaec1196923e3c5e61016af87c71d OP_EQUAL
address
3Fjg81g3qcbaUum3aAL75JUwtYmmmiPS7c
transaction
d27f0bf39eb7990b11a0531543349fdf691ac7ababd327eb00b702239cc9d0f6
confirmations
345580
spent
true